## v4.8.0 — Changed defaults

Starting with this release, Mailwren's batch email digest scheduler defaults to hourly consolidation instead of per-event dispatch. Tenants upgraded in place will inherit the new default unless they previously pinned a schedule; pinned schedules are preserved verbatim. We also lowered the default batch ceiling to 500 recipients per digest window to reduce queue backpressure on the Torvane cluster. Before approving the rollout, verify the effective values below against staging.

deployment values, kajep-kageg:
[praix]
host = praix.paliqcorp.corp
user = praix_svc
database = praix_prod

Ticket #4182: Fix N+1 queries in FernGraph resolver

Heads up for the security review — the `orders.lineItems` resolver on Pellwick's FernGraph API was firing one query per item, so a crafted query could hammer the DB (mild DoS vector). Fixed with a batched dataloader and a depth cap of 8. No auth paths touched, but please sanity-check the new batching doesn't leak rows across tenants. Patched build is referenced just below.

build token for kagaf-hahof: htk14_9d3d4d26d7d8de

## WebSocket Compression at Lanternbyte

Our Driftrelay gateway supports permessage-deflate, but we disable it for high-frequency telemetry streams: CPU cost outweighs bandwidth savings below 2 KB payloads. Enable it only for chat and document sync channels. Config changes require unlocking the gateway settings store, which new team members do once during setup. Enter the recovery passphrase shown below when the unlock prompt appears.

vault phrase of hawif-bahof = novvan-belius-istael-fenvan-holdor-druox-eliath

Quick note for the sync: we're trialing Fabrikweave, the new test-data factory library from Quillmark Systems, on the billing test suite. Early results are good — fixtures are way less brittle. Their support contract covers four response hours a week, which seems plenty. If you hit weirdness with nested factories, ping their support desk.

alerts address for kajog-tadup: druox@plorvanet.internal